Transaction e63c033647e732179099e4f08af1f80f25562641003768204b646fa0eefc85d6
1 Input
1 Output
-
e63c033647e732179099e4f08af1f80f25562641003768204b646fa0eefc85d6:0
- value
- 273980
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f123fb984f87fd4c51ed67b8e7020e9cb5f77f2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KstjfenKZMArJFatFp1kKAPDrdzMkuUKD